| Description | Band of netted beadwork of glass beads. The ground is green; along the middle is a stripe composed of lozenges of various colours; red and yellow; red, yellow, and white; red, yellow, and blue. To the ends are attached short strings of white, red, yellow, or blue glsas beads caught together at their distal ends. See 37-22-69 (girl's costume) |
